This study aims to explain the meaning of the term Khilafa in the Qur`an, and shed light on its link with the concept of Leadership. The most comprehensive verse in the Qur`an indicating this issue is the Verse 30 of Sura Baqara. It should be noted that the Succession which is mentioned in the verse is the most superior of all the creatures, and has some distinctive features from them. In Shiite perspective, the Imamate and the position of general position of succession of the prophets is assigned and conducted by God in all aspects including this world and afterword. In short, Imam of every age is one who is appointed by God. In contrast, form the Sunnite view, Imamate is a general leadership which is aimed at protecting people on behalf of the each one of the prophets. For Shi`a, therefore, there is no difference bet-ween the concept of Imam and the quranic Caliph. The two terms are logically the same. On the contrary, Imam for Sunnis implies a concept of the leadership from God only in administration and coordination of daily life of people. Thus, based on the Sunnite defini-tion, the political expert with the ability of implementing of Sentences is eligible for the position of Imam. Khalifa al-Allah, that guardian of God, intermediate of grace and the teacher of angels is not comparable with Sunni's imam.

Shahid Sadr divides interpretation into two types: sequential and thematic. In his view, by referring to thematic interpretation, we can achieve Quranic doctrine about significant life issues. Shahid Sadr has various exegetical works in thematic approach. In Shahid Sadr’s view, holy quran has recommendation on history and its prevailing traditions. Shahid Sadr’s pre-assumptions are scientific originality and quranic doctrine based on certain academic principles. This research aims to, among these methods, analyze the one by which this interpreter and quran scholar explain quranic doctrine of (history traditions). Theory of this commentator includes some elements such as system approach and induction, that by using these, he has modified and consolidated theory of (historical traditions) in quran. Shahid Sadr’s historical theory on the basis of accepted exegetical basics and principles and rules from his point of view, is appreciable and explainable.

Noah as a Lawgiver Prophet (ulu al-azm) in Islam and one of the most eminent personages of the Bible in Judaism and Christianity is among the most prominent individuals. The story of the Flood has been narrated with some differences not only among the Semitic peoples, but also among the people of other regions in the world. This article deals with a comparative study of one of the basic elements of this story, i.e. the Ark of Noah, and compares the accounts of the sacred texts of the two religions of Islam and Judaism on this matter from different aspects. Various subjects as revelation to Noah to make the Ark, planting trees to provide its wood, its structure, duration of its construction, mocking Noah during its building and allegorical viewpoint concerning it are discussed in this paper.

In commentary of the Holy Qur'an terminology, al-Mizan the eminent exegesis book of Allama Tabatabaie, is one of the best in this field in which the outher used noticeable "al-Mufradat fi Gharib al-Quran" by Raghib. In this paper, we will study amount and method of Allama Tabatabai’s use of the book. This article based on library written paper investigates some cases of these usages and classifies them. Some of these usages are: to criticize the views of other commentators, to prefer Raghib's views over the other terminologists, to fill out his views in some cases, acceptance his views, to approve his views by using context.

The Holy Quran stresses on the divine nature's principle of the mankind called "fitra" in quranic terminology, and bases its appeal on it. According to the Holy Quran, this divine nature is the monotheistic structure of whole universe and the human kind as a fragment of it. The article aims to study three principal parts: the notion of this nature (fitra) and its sphere that covers the whole universe and existence, the concordance of the language in its general characteristics with this divine nature (fitra) and at last the concordance of the language of Quran as a particular case with this divine nature. All of these refer to the Almighty God and it has been the principal cause of Islam development in earlier centuries; so the Islamic umma should apply on it in its present discourse and address with the modern world.
